Winning the Leagues Cup with Inter Miami helped Lionel Messi surpass Dani Alves to become the player with the most collective titles in football history.

Messi has won 44 titles, after winning with Inter Miami against host Nashville in the 2023 Leagues Cup final on the morning of August 20, Hanoi time. This is his first title with Miami, and also the first championship in this team’s history. Messi surpassed former teammate Dani Alves – who once held the record of winning 43 titles in history.

Alves claims he has won 43 titles in history, not counting achievements in lower leagues. The three players with rich achievements right behind him are Andres Iniesta with 39, Gerard Pique and Maxwell with 37 titles respectively. All five of the most successful players in football history have in common that they played for Barca under Pep Guardiola.

Messi has won the most titles at Barca, with 35 championships including 10 La Liga, 7 King’s Cups, 8 Spanish Super Cups, 4 Champions Leagues, 3 European Super Cups and 3 FIFA Club World Cups. He won three more titles at PSG, including two Ligue 1 and one French Super Cup. Messi won five titles with Argentina, including the World Cup, Copa America, Intercontinental Cup, U20 World Cup and Olympic gold medal. The 2023 Leagues Cup championship helps him complete the above record. The only tournament Messi has ever participated in without winning is the French Cup.

Messi has played 48 cup matches in his career, scoring 35 goals and assisting 15 times. On average, in a cup match, he will score or assist. In the match against Nashville, the 36-year-old superstar shot from long range to the top corner close to the post to open the score, although Miami later equalized. In the penalty shootout, Miami beat Nashville 10-9, down to the goalkeeper’s shootout, to take the crown.

The Leagues Cup is a tournament for strong clubs from North America and Mexico, competing from the regional group stage to the knockout round. Messi played 7 matches in the tournament, scored 10 goals, assisted once, and won the Best Player of the tournament. He scored in every match, winning the top scorer award.

Messi is only two matches away from his 45th title, as Miami has reached the US Open semi-finals. They will meet Cincinnati in the semi-finals on the morning of August 24, Hanoi time, and the final will take place four days later. Miami reached the semi-finals of this tournament without Messi, even though they are still at the bottom of the MLS East table.
